    Bubble chart with two threshold horizontal lines

    Hello,

    I just want to know if it is possible create a Bubble chart with two threshold horizontal lines in excel 2007.
    I have to insert on the bubble chart two lines (10% and 16%).

    Re: Bubble chart with two threshold horizontal lines

    I would try adding another data series consisting of:

    X value -- max x
    Y value -- 0.1 and 0.16
    size -- any reasonably value

    Then select this series and add error bars to that series. Delete the vertical error bars, then format the horizontal error bars so that only the negative error bar shows and set it to 100%. Then set the size value to 0 to hide this second series, leaving only the negative horizontal error bar visible.

    Re: Bubble chart with two threshold horizontal lines

    But, I have one doubt, on the bubble chart i use 3 series:

    Series 1 - Product name
    Series 2 - Damage (in %)
    Series 3 - Bubble Size (Total of product)
    I think you are misunderstanding. Those three sets of values together constitute a single data series.

    How i add the series 4 to the bubble chart?
    I frequently use the "Select Data" dialog to add data series. Select the chart -> Design -> Select Data -> Add -> Select the desired ranges/values for X values, Y values, size values, and name for the new series. Exit the diaglogs, then continue adding error bars to this new series.
